Multiple Choice Questions: Another Way to Do Them

10

There is another way to do multiple-choice questions:

  • Identify the key words (the most important words) in the question.

  • Find the part of the passage that gives the answer.

  • Try to answer the question yourself.

  • Look at the options and find the one that matches your answer.

Grammar Focus: The Present Perfect

20

Look at this example:

  • Globalisation has affected most aspects of our lives.

  • Did this happen in the past or present?

  • It began in the past.

  • Does it have result in the present?

  • Yes, we are still affected by globalisation.

Slide image

21

Another Example

  • Different countries have benefitted from the globalisation of education in many different ways.

  • Did this happen in the past of the present?

  • It began in the past. These countries benefitted from the globalisation of education.

  • Do these countries still benefit from the globalisation of education in the present?

  • Yes, they do. These countries still benefit from the globalisation of education.

22

Example:

  • Many people in rural areas have not even had a primary education.

  • Did they have a primary education in the past?

  • No, they didn't.

  • What's the effect in the present?

  • They aren't educated.

Exam Skills: Multiple Choice Question

  • Read (skim) the text very quickly so you understand what it is about.

  • Read the main part of the questions and find the key words.

  • Find the key words that mean the same in the passage.

  • Try to answer the options without looking at the options A-D.

  • Find the option A,B,C,or D that matches your answer.

  • Check the other options are incorrect.
